Car
If you're traveling by car, start from the center of Nordland and head towards E6 highway. Follow the E6 northbound towards Narvik. Once you reach Narvik, take the exit towards the city center. Continue on Kongensgate, and you'll find the Narvik War Museum located at Kongensgate 39, 8514 Narvik. Parking may be available nearby, but be sure to check for any parking fees.
Public Transportation
For those using public transportation, you can take a bus from various locations in Nordland to Narvik. Check the local bus schedules for routes to Narvik. Once you arrive at the Narvik bus station, it is a short walk to the museum. Head southeast on Storgata, then turn right onto Kongensgate. The museum will be on your left at Kongensgate 39. Be sure to check the bus fares and schedules in advance.
Taxi
If you prefer a more direct route, consider taking a taxi from your location in Nordland to Narvik. Taxi services are available and can be booked via local taxi companies. The fare will depend on your starting point, so it's advisable to ask for an estimate before starting your journey. Upon arriving in Narvik, request the driver to take you to Kongensgate 39.
